Artist Statement for Dan Meyer

Artist Statement: By Dan G. Meyer, November 2006

Thanks for taking the time to look at my work and for reading this. If you found the work interesting, take a moment and please sign my guestbook. I enjoy the feedback.

I make pictures, that's my job. Your job is to really see what I have done. I don't know which is harder!

As a rule I try not to talk to much about painting. I talked art in my youth and with time it has been my experience that one could talk about it or one could do it. This for me created a great work ethic. I have friends, painters who talk the greatest paintings ever made and when they do paint they agonize over every brush stroke, justifying everything they do. For me, better to be a man of action. Better to just do it, trust my knowledge and cut the dead wood out with time. In the end a painter is remembered by what he painted not by what he said about it. I leave words to the art historians, if there are any. I did my part.

The world turns, the artist paints. I follow my muse, rallying the memories of past work and see through that to what possibilities might be and that is enough!

I was lucky enough to get a studio art education, with a BFA that I received in 1978, in painting and printmaking from Parsons School Of Design in New York City. I live and work (quietly) now in a house that I built in 1981 on twelve acres of land with my wife Sarah, in the beautiful Butternut Valley of central New York State where there is a small, but thriving, art community.

My work can be found in many private collections in the United States and my giclee prints, that I started producing six years ago, are in selected print galleries in the United States. I try to have a one-man show each year of my work and as many group shows as I can squeeze into my schedule without effecting my time too adversely in the studio.
